The Glenwood Historic District in Thomasville, Georgia is a historic district which was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 2010. The Joe M. Beutell House is in the historic district and is separately listed. The area designated is approximately the area bounded by Euclid Avenue on the east, East Jackson Street on the south, Glenwood Drive on the west, and Clay Street on the north. It was developed as Glenwood subdivision in 1925, by the developer and realtor J. B. Jemison. It was deemed significant in part "for its design by I. O. Freeman of Atlanta, a civil engineer who promoted a 'system of winding driveways and dignified home sites' with native vegetation and landscape features that are still apparent today."

When was Glenwood Historic District listed on the National Register?
Glenwood Historic District was listed on the National Register of Historic Places on October 13, 2010.
What type of historic resource is Glenwood Historic District?
Glenwood Historic District is classified as a district in the National Register of Historic Places.
What is the period of significance for Glenwood Historic District?
The period of significance for Glenwood Historic District is recorded as the industrial era, specifically around 1925.
